logo

Output 1676281705ba7647db80b6e31358c9cb36e32ddb589103afd4b79ae3ecfd2865:1

value
566967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abed18bc98e31d44a65d76c38bb976db9df66fdc OP_EQUAL
address
3HN5W7Ho38ytqLFeSwGS6htizuwnot8Fx5
transaction
1676281705ba7647db80b6e31358c9cb36e32ddb589103afd4b79ae3ecfd2865